use ExtUtils::MakeMaker; use strict; use warnings; my $RngStreams_lib=""; my $RngStreams_inc=""; @ARGV = map { if (/^RNGSTREAMS_LIB=(.*)/) { $RngStreams_lib = "-L$1 "; () } elsif (/^RNGSTREAMS_INCLUDE=(.*)/) { $RngStreams_inc = "-I$1 "; () } else { $_ } } @ARGV; WriteMakefile( NAME => 'Math::RngStream', VERSION_FROM => 'lib/Math/RngStream.pm', PREREQ_PM => {}, AUTHOR => 'Salvador Fandino ', LIBS => ["${RngStreams_lib}-lrngstreams"], INC => "${RngStreams_inc}-I.", DEFINE => '', # e.g., '-DHAVE_SOMETHING' );